Identifying Historic Paint

A Guide to the Significance of Paint in Historic Structures

When working in a historic building or embarking on a preservation project, we are often tasked with the questions: what do we have?

Many historic buildings uniquely express themselves with their interior paint finishes. Looking to the history of the building or space, there may be a reason to look beneath the surface.

The purpose of this guide is to help you identify whether or not investigating further is something to consider for your project and how to determine the significance of the finishes.

With this guide you will be able to:

  • Determine whether you have something worth investigating.
  • Understand the role of the conservator.
  • Evaluate cases where it may be necessary to take a deeper look into the finishes.
